PSA: People’s Climate March 2014

Just in case you haven’t been paying attention to your local enviro-news outlet, one of the most important and influential parades will be taking place in not only New York City, but in Paris, Melbourne, Rio De Janeiro,  London, Berlin and other spots in the world. In NY, hundreds of organizations have assembled between 77th and 81st on Central Park West to protest climate change deniers and demand for progressive action against the environmental threat.  The march will begin roughly at 11:30 am all the way down to 34th street. Lurid Illustrations: Valerie Hegarty

 Dining Room, Cane Acres Plantation, Summerville, South Carolina.
Image: Brooklyn Museum

If you’re in NYC, now’s an excellent time to view the works of Valerie Hegarty in her current exhibit titled “Alternative Histories”. Right at the Brooklyn Museum on the 4th floor, you can view Hegarty’s displays, which portray themes including “colonization, Manifest Destiny, and repressed history.” Hegarty uses a myriad of media to build these metaphorical and organic chaos and decay scenes.
